P3 Reports are performance reports used by Pampered Chef consultants to track their sales, customer interactions, and overall business performance. These reports help consultants analyze their progress and make informed decisions to improve their sales strategies.
If your P3 Reports are not loading, it could be due to several reasons, including server issues, internet connectivity problems, or browser compatibility. Ensure you have a stable internet connection and try refreshing the page. If the problem persists, check if there are any known outages or maintenance updates from Pampered Chef.
To troubleshoot P3 Reports, start by clearing your browser's cache and cookies, as this can resolve loading issues. Additionally, try accessing the reports using a different browser or device. If you continue to experience problems, consider reaching out to Pampered Chef support for further assistance.
Yes, P3 Reports may be temporarily unavailable during scheduled maintenance or updates to the Pampered Chef system. It's advisable to check the Pampered Chef website or social media channels for any announcements regarding maintenance schedules that may affect report accessibility.
If you need help with P3 Reports, you can contact Pampered Chef's customer support team through their official website. They offer assistance via phone, email, or live chat.
